Simple Vanilla Cupcakes with Buttercream

These vanilla cupcakes are light, fluffy, and topped with a classic buttercream frosting. This small-batch recipe is ideal when you want a sweet treat without the commitment of a full batch.

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 tablespoons milk
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on milk

Method

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a muffin tin with 6 cupcake liners.
  2. In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
  3. In a larger bowl, beat together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  4. Add the egg and vanilla extract to the butter mixture and beat until combined.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, alternating with the milk, and mix until smooth.
  6. Divide the batter evenly among the cupcake liners and b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  7. Let the cupcakes cool in the pan for a few min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
  8. To make the buttercream, beat together the powdered sugar, butter, vanilla extract, and milk until smooth and creamy. Frost the cooled cupcakes as desired.
